Abstract
An algorithmic approach is presented that leads to reduction in the computational requirements for process system dynamic reliability and safety analysis using discrete state transition models through the utilization of vector processing and a sparse matrix technique. The new algorithm is demonstrated on an example system taken from boiling water reactors. The results show reduction in random access memory requirements by a factor of 20 and reduction in the computational time by a factor of 7 with respect to the original algorithm.
